



Marshan Park
Marshan Park in Tangier is a lush oasis of tranquility and natural beauty that offers visitors a refreshing escape from the city’s vibrant pace. Situated at the foothills of the Mediterranean with sweeping views of the sea, the park is a beloved spot for both locals and travelers seeking relaxation and scenic vistas. Its well-maintained gardens are filled with a diverse array of native and exotic plants, creating a vibrant tapestry of colors and aromas. The park’s pathways wind through shaded groves and open lawns, making it perfect for leisurely strolls or picnics under the sun. Historically, Marshan has been a fashionable district since the early 20th century, and the park complements this elegant neighborhood with its charming ambiance and leafy surroundings. What makes Marshan Park especially unique is the blend of natural serenity and cultural history, with nearby colonial-style villas and historic sites adding to its allure. Visitors can enjoy panoramic views of the Strait of Gibraltar, watching ships pass by and savoring the salty sea breeze. Whether seeking a quiet retreat or a picturesque spot for photography, Marshan Park offers a peaceful yet inspiring vibe that captures the essence of Tangier’s diverse character.
